After driving by this place many time over the past two years we finally ordered dinner. We ordered chicken pad Thai 5 stars, pad see ew with tofu 1 star plus chicken spring rolls. The food was excellent and my only regret is that I didn’t try this sooner. This will be our new go to Thai place in West Chester. If you love the heat 5 stars (their top spice leve) is not that hot. I hope as we order more from food fro here they will give my food an extra kick after they get to know us

I had the yellow curry, spicy lv1. Although the flavor was middle of the road and the rice was both too dry and too mushy (for my tastes), the onions were so smoooth!! And the portion for $11 ($10.95 for lunch) was solid.
CONCLUSION - I'm satisfied, y'all. I only came here cuz I was in a rush and it was nearby. There are better Thai spots around town. But I don't regret this choice.
